boost them all!
while i have NO issues with that ideology, are there any 1.5BAR MAP sensors out there? if so, the PCM would still need to know it and then scale everything accordingly.
if there aren't and there is only 1,2 and higher, WTF is the point of going up to ~1.5BAR? the 1BAR can't read it and a 2BAR should read to ~210kPa... so why 140?
was the LSD making rounds that day? or did someone not scale the VE tables correctly when they hacked through it? if you had a testbench, it would be easy enough to determine, but i find it more likely that the 4 extra entries in that table are actually 25,35,45,55 kPa. above 100 just doesn't make sense in a program that can only see up to 100...
